Vilitra is a generic medication that contains Vardenafil, which is similar to Sildenafil (Viagra) and Tadalafil (Cialis). It's used to treat erectile dysfunction (ED) by improving blood flow to the penis, which helps men achieve and maintain an erection during sexual stimulation. Effectiveness for Older Men: Vilitra is effective for many men, including older individuals. Vardenafil, the active ingredient, works by inhibiting the PDE5 enzyme, which allows for better blood flow to the penis. Since erectile dysfunction becomes more common with age, especially as testosterone levels decrease and other health issues like heart disease, diabetes, and hypertension become more prevalent, many older men find Vardenafil (Vilitra) to be a good option to help them regain sexual function. 2. Dosage and Starting Point: For older men, the usual starting dose of Vilitra is 10 mg, and this can be adjusted based on how well the medication is tolerated and its effectiveness. The dose can be increased to 20 mg or reduced to 5 mg, depending on individual needs. Vilitra 10 mg is typically taken about 30 minutes to 1 hour before sexual activity, and its effects can last 4–6 hours. 3. Considerations for Older Men: Heart and Circulatory Health: Many older men may have conditions such as high blood pressure, coronary artery disease, or diabetes. Since Vilitra (like other PDE5 inhibitors) affects blood pressure and blood vessels, older men with cardiovascular issues should take extra care and consult a doctor before using it.
